Output 91ef83665f3050fc0570a57f71dc3ac86f7c86dca7a4385eb009a0e6e6ff317a:634

value
331156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 25e58d524e8d4f670825e0eaefab8d5588fa1d493483a850b8131566bf905358
address
tb1pyhjc65jw348kwzp9ur4wl2ud2ky0582fxjp6s59czv2kd0us2dvq852mqa
transaction
91ef83665f3050fc0570a57f71dc3ac86f7c86dca7a4385eb009a0e6e6ff317a
spent
false

1 Sat Range